Introduction
The MIL-S4800 Switch is a multi-port Switch that can be used to build
high-performance switched workgroup networks. This switch is a
store-and-forward device that offers low latency for high-speed networking and is
targeted at workgroup, department or backbone computing environment. The
MIL-S4800 Switch has 48 auto-sensing 10/100Base-TX RJ-45 ports, 1
10/100/1000T port and 1 SFP port for higher connection speed.
Features
Confirm to IEEE802.3 10BASE-T, 802.3u 100BASE-TX,IEEE 802.3ab
1000Base-T IEEE802.3z Gigabit Fiber
48-port 10/100TX plus 1 10/100/1000T port and 1 SFP port
Switch Fabric up to 20Gbps
Non-Blocking Architecture
IEEE802.3x Flow Control
Flow Control with Full Duplex
Back Pressure with Half Duplex
2 x Gigabit uplink port
19” rack mount design
